Comments by Mark Schiedes

 

Mike Shedd - Mike Valvo [A87] Coop99 Open R2
1.c4 f5 2.d4 g6 3.Nc3 Nf6 4.Nf3 Bg7 5.g3 0-0 6.Bg2 d6 7.0-0 Qe8 8.Re1 Nc6 9.d5 Na5 10.Nb5 Qd8 11.Qc2 c6 12.Nbd4 cxd5 13.Ng5 Qb6 14.Nde6 Bxe6 15.Nxe6 Rfc8 16.Be3 Qa6 17.b3 dxc4 18.b4 Nc6 DIAGRAM Shedd-Valvo W19 19.Qc3 Bh8 20.Rac1 d5 21.Qd2 Qb5 22.Bc5 Ne4 23.Bxe4 dxe4 24.a4 Qxa4 25.Qd5 Nxb4 26.Bxb4 Qc6 [26...Qxb4? 27.Ng5+ soon mates. 27...Kg7 28.Qf7+ Kh6 29.Qxh7+ Kxg5 30.Qh4#] 27.Nf4+ [27.Nc7+ as pointed out by the elder Ponomarev after the game, appears to give White chances to hold the game. However, it's still a difficult posittion. 27...Qxd5 28.Nxd5 Kf7 29.Nxe7] 27...e6! this move shows that 27.Nf4 and 27.Nc7 are not equivalent! 28.Qxe6+ Qxe6 29.Nxe6 a5 30.Bc3 b5 and here it appears the 3 pawns are just stronger than the knight. 31.Bxh8 Kxh8 32.Nd4 [32.Red1 seems to be a better try at defense, but probably ultimately futile.] 32...b4 33.Rb1 Kg7 34.Rec1 Kf6 35.e3 Ke5 36.Kf1 Kd5 37.Ke2 c3 38.Rb3 Kc4 39.Rcb1 Rab8 40.Nc2 Rd8 41.Ke1 Rd2 42.Nd4 Rxd4 43.exd4 c2 0-1
